w w w. p a s s i v e c o m p o n e n t . c o m rf devices & high frequency inductors multilayer chip varistor (mlv) - vz series & vh series vh 0402 m 050 c g t 330 - type code v: walsin zno varistor h: high speed and rf, and special capacitance concern z: general purpose chip size 0402, 0603 0805, 1206 code is l x w (in inches) 0402 = 0.4 x 0.2 0603 = 0.6 x 0.3 0805 = 0.8 x 0.5 1206 = 1.2 x 0.6 style m: multilayer a: array* rated voltage 050: 5.5vdc 090: 9.0vdc 120: 12.0vdc 140: 14.0vdc 180: 18.0vdc 300: 30.0vdc cap. tolerance a: typ. capacitance for z series c: max. capacitance for h series termination g : green material packing t=reeled b=bulk cap. code (pf) this item is only for h series. two significant digits followed by number of zeros 3r0=3pf when c < 10pf 330=33x10 0 =33pf 101=10x10 1 =100pf 102=10x10 2 =1000pf special request how to order introduction - plated & lead-free termination high speed esd voltage suppressor is an advanced series of walsins multilayer chip varistor (mlv). nowadays, more and more communication devices become compact and apply denser and higher frequency circuits inside. protection against the electronic static discharge (esd) generated from human body transient voltage surge is more important when downsize of high-speed transistor makes its vulnerability to esd and surge. walsins high speed esd voltage suppressor provides protection from esd and eft in high-speed data line and radio frequency (rf) circuits. also, if capacitance of mlv is a concern to circuit designers, walsin mlv h series would supply a solution, mlv with specified capacitance and range. it is compatible with modern reflow and wave soldering procedures. w e would give you a solution to transient over voltage and esd protection to your products. *array: please contact sales for availability features ? multilayer fabrication technology ? small size (0402 & 0603) ? -55oc to 125oc operating temperature range ? operating voltage range v m (dc) at 5.5v ~ 85v ? able to withstand esd test of iec-61000-4-2 ? bi-directional clamping characteristic ? stanard / low / customized capacitance types available applications ? protection of cellular phones, pda, high speed data line...etc. ? esd protection for components sensitive to iec 61000-4-2, provides circuit board transient voltage protection for transistors. ? protection of video & audio ports. dimensions t e r m i n a t i o n w a l a t size 0402 0603 0805 1206 l 1.00 0.10 1.60 0.15 2.00 0.20 3.20 0.20 w 0.50 0.10 0.80 0.15 1.25 0.20 1.60 0.20 t 0.50 0.10 0.80 0.15 0.80 0.20 0.80 0.10* 1.10 0.20** a 0.25 0.15 0.35 0.15 0.50 0.20 0.65 0.25 note: * means vz1206 5.5vdc~22vdc items ** means vz1206 26vdc~85vdc items unit: mm 39
